A people-first approach
For over 15 years, I’ve been creating films that put people at the centre. My work starts with understanding the story — what drives it, who it comes from and why it matters. I support contributors so they feel at ease, guiding them with steady direction and clear communication.
Whether I’m producing branded content, charity films or documentary pieces, I focus on the human details that make a story meaningful. Clients rely on me for a calm, reliable presence and films shaped by a strong sense of narrative.

BRITISH SILVER ARROW
AWARD for VOLKSWAGEN: ERUM’S STORY
I’m honoured that Erum’s Story — a film I directed, shot and edited for Volkswagen’s Yourwagen campaign has been recognised with a Silver Arrow at the British Arrows Awards in the Automotive category.
This project meant a great deal to me. As a self-shooting director and editor, I had the opportunity to help share Erum’s experience with honesty and care. Working on this film reminded me why I’m drawn to this kind of work: finding the human thread in someone’s story and shaping it into something that resonates.

COUNT ME IN
Feature-length Netflix documentary
Count Me In celebrates the spirit of drumming and the people who dedicate their lives to rhythm. The film follows a cast of drummers as they reflect on their journeys — from childhood beginnings to performing on some of the world’s biggest stages — and on the musicians who influenced them along the way.
I worked on the documentary as part of the production team, contributing to the film’s interview-led, story-driven approach. Projects like this strongly reflect the style of work I’m drawn to: real people, open conversations, and stories shaped through lived experience.
